Subject: DR drill — Greenhouse controller sensor drift

Team, tomorrow's disaster-recovery drill for the Verdanta greenhouse controller will simulate the humidity sensor drift we saw at the Millbrook site. Support should expect synthetic alerts between 09:00 and 11:00; do not escalate them. If the controller fails over, restore the calibration profile from the cold backup per runbook section 4. To unseal the backup archive, use the passphrase below.

strongbox words: norwyn-wenael-aldvan-aldiel-wendor-holael

Ticket: Staging env misconfigured for Siftgate bloom filter

The bloom layer in front of the Pellet KV store is rejecting all lookups in staging because the env file was copied from the dev template without credentials. False-positive tuning values are fine; only the auth line is missing. To unblock the weekly demo, the Pellet admission secret must be set on the following line.

env line for yaguf-fajop: LEDGER_TOKEN13=fb08984397349

## Key ceremony checklist — item 7

- [ ] Before rotating the Threadline signing keys, confirm the websocket reconnect bug (clients storm-reconnecting after key swaps) is patched in gateway v4.2. If it isn't, the ceremony will trigger a reconnect flood in the Bramwick cluster. Once verified, the ceremony laptop will ask for the quorum recovery credential, so have everyone confirm the passphrase below.

vault phrase of kawep-tahog = ulaix-briath